Earlier Grade-1 T/A check-hook hammer guns were made with Laminated Steel barrels and Grade-0 T/A check-hook hammer guns were made with Twist Steel barrels. That may be where the confusion in printed literature lies for this particular gun.
It is obviously a Grade-1 gun by the P stamped on the water table. Laminated Steel barrels had generally been phased out nearly two decades earlier, save for a few sets of barrels remaining in the back of the bin in Meriden that were used on very rare occasions until they were gone.
